Dictionary definition

Covered with a smooth shiny coating or having a shiny, glassy look.

Example sentences

Glazed in a sentence

easy

The donuts were glazed with sweet icing.

medium

The pottery looked glazed and bright after it cooled.

hard

Glazed can describe food, pottery, or a surface with a shiny coating.
